Candias - Meaning of Candias
What does Candias mean?
[ syll. can-dias, ca-ndi-as ] The baby girl name Candias is pronounced KAENDiyAHZ †. Candias is of African-Ethiopia origin and it is used mainly in English. Candias is a variant transcription of Candace (English).
